Transaction a676b9701b9ca7fbadaae9ab8823f9e22f65ef5be857f120162af5a3efcecfc7

85 Input
1 Outputs
  • a676b9701b9ca7fbadaae9ab8823f9e22f65ef5be857f120162af5a3efcecfc7:0
  • value  710857841
    address  32xVqh1vrregQegzkggfDnM4q4SzvecP45